grilled guacamole

Grilling the vegetables add smokey depth to the already rich flavors of the guacamole.

prep time 5 Min
cook time 10 Min
method Grill
yield 4 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 4 - avocados, halved and pitted
  • 1/8 cup olive oil, extra virgin
  • 1/2 - yellow onion, 1/2" slices
  • 4 cloves garlic, peeled
  • 1 - jalapeno, halved and seeded
  • 1 - lemon, halved
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ons sea slat
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 bunch cilantro, chopped

How To Make grilled guacamole

  • Step 1
    Brush avocados with 1 tablespoon oil.
  • Step 2
    Grill, meat side down, on grill for 2-3 minutes.
  • Step 3
    Drizzle with remaining olive oil and gently toss.
  • Step 4
    Grill vegetables and lemon until onions are translucent, about 5 minutes.
  • Step 5
    Remove flesh from avocados with spoon.
  • Step 6
    In a bowl, mash the avocado meat with fork, leaving it relatively chunky.
  • Step 7
    Add juice from the grilled lemon and season with salt and pepper.
  • Step 8
    Meanwhile, roughly chop the rest of the grilled vegetables and fold into the avocado mixture.
  • Step 9
    Add more salt to taste, if needed. Finish with cilantro.
